Output af6aa0069e96756bd4ebf0621793a9feeb1c7474ef6a31bc490dbc32fbdf0a61:0

value
628580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708885e0c0b9de2975f8f9f564ec2b539a86163c OP_EQUAL
address
3Bx39oxL6hyozR52rP7BsonK8JujwSvBMQ
transaction
af6aa0069e96756bd4ebf0621793a9feeb1c7474ef6a31bc490dbc32fbdf0a61
confirmations
310680
spent
true